Abstract

[In order to fulfill the growing demand high-performance low RCS antenna in stealth technology, FSS-based antenna is found to be the better candidate. In view of this, the design and analysis of microstrip patch antennas (MPA) loaded with (i) FSS-based HIS (high-impedance surface) ground plane and (ii) FSS-based superstrate are presented in this book with proper formulations and graphical presentations.]
